Over the past 28 years, there have been 16 property sales recorded in the CR2 7NE postcode area. The highest sale price reached £722,000, while the most recent sale was for a semi-detached house sold in June 2023 for £590,000.
The estimated average property value in CR2 7NE currently stands at £679,761, which is approximately 41.2% higher than the city average, indicating a potentially more desirable or in-demand location.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£5,374.
Property prices in CR2 7NE have risen by 3.3% over the past year , with a total increase of 10.2%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 45.2%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is semi-detached, making up around 81% of transactions , followed by terraced and detached.
Housing in CR2 7NE is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 75% of homes being lived in by the owners.
